Burnout

T14380660
'Like the planet I'm trying to save I am screaming - and you want me to speak of hope?' Amara meets Bridgette at a protest, one of them, 'hippy, green, save-the-planet' things. She's just popped out to grab some milk and now she's late - and there's a flood coming. Bridgette's a committed activist. Amara's about to finish her GCSEs. Their town's been flooded. Again. But how's getting arrested going to help anything? They can't afford to do that.
Author Nicole Acquah

Production details

Burnout was created with climate activists across the UK. The show exposes the burnout experienced by activists from marginalised communities alongside the burnout of our planet. It's a call to action for audiences to think about privilege, activism and climate justice.
